What is the difference between Sr Azure Devops Engineer vs Azure Cloud Engineer?

AspectSr Azure Devops EngineerAzure Cloud Engineer
CertificationsAzure DevOps, Azure Solutions Architect, or similarAzure Fundamentals, Azure Administrator, or similar
Work EnvironmentFocus on CI/CD pipelines, automation, and DevOps practices within AzureManage and deploy Azure cloud infrastructure and services
Industry UsageUsed in organizations adopting DevOps methodologies for software deliveryUsed in organizations managing cloud infrastructure and migrations

The main difference is that Sr Azure Devops Engineers specialize in implementing DevOps practices, CI/CD pipelines, and automation within Azure environments, while Azure Cloud Engineers focus on managing and deploying Azure infrastructure and services. Both roles require Azure certifications and are vital in cloud-based organizations, but their core responsibilities differ in scope and focus.

What does a Sr Azure DevOps Engineer do?

A Sr Azure DevOps Engineer is responsible for designing, implementing, and managing the DevOps processes and tools on the Microsoft Azure cloud platform. They automate software deployments, manage CI/CD pipelines, ensure infrastructure as code, and work closely with development and operations teams to enable efficient software delivery. Additionally, they monitor system performance, troubleshoot issues, and maintain security and compliance within Azure environments.

What are some common challenges faced by Sr Azure DevOps Engineers when managing CI/CD pipelines in large organizations?

Sr Azure DevOps Engineers often encounter challenges such as maintaining consistent pipeline configurations across multiple teams, ensuring secure and efficient integration of various tools, and managing the complexity that comes with scaling deployments to accommodate numerous services or microservices. Additionally, coordinating with developers, QA, and operations teams to troubleshoot pipeline failures and implementing robust monitoring can be demanding. Proactive communication and automation best practices are essential for overcoming these hurdles and ensuring smooth, reliable delivery processes.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Sr Azure DevOps Engineer?

To thrive as a Sr Azure DevOps Engineer, you need advanced expertise in cloud infrastructure, CI/CD pipelines, automation, and strong scripting skills, typically supported by a degree in computer science or a related field. Mastery of tools like Azure DevOps, Terraform, Docker, Kubernetes, and certifications such as Microsoft Certified: Azure DevOps Engineer Expert are highly valued. Excellent problem-solving, collaboration, and communication skills help you work effectively with cross-functional teams and manage complex deployments. These skills ensure robust, scalable, and secure application delivery in modern cloud environments.
